WHEN THE WORLD AT LAST IS QUIET

When the world at last is quiet, and finally

those staying up all night talking and spreading lies

shut up, the whole stupidity and waste of the world sinks,

with a final groan of despair, and is gone,

every person, who endlessly in their minds think of themselves as kind and worthy,

those hypocrites gone, too, as well as the pitiful and humble, unable to sleep,

expressions, “it’s not too shabby,” phrases, “late at night last night at the station,”

writing exercises, gone, gone, gone,

the words “anxiety,” “psychology,” “mystery,” “boss,” “work,”

poof—forgotten as if they never existed—

the dogs chewing, the wild and disturbing hunting and slaughter of nature,

the self-righteous poetry, oh when at last it all shuts up,

nothing to say, no pitiful wants and desires, no more hunger that it sag and droop and feed and go on,

the whole writhing mess silent at last, life humming and moaning,

oh God shut up, the world (stupid word, “world”) able to nap peacefully at last,

I shall rejoice; even Mozart will rejoice,

you don’t need to defend anything with all those notes! sleep, sleep Mozart,

rest, oh God we are so tired, no, I never really loved you,

alright, alright, maybe for a time, but please, military, murder scenes, cop shows, odd taste in clothing,

just end, enough, enough, I don’t want to travel, I don’t care what it looks like in Zanzibar

or Korea or Africa, quaint New England, white fences,

blue houses, liquor stores, good bye, good bye, shut up, shut up, yes, yes, good night,

children growing up too fast, bye, bye, time to be quiet now,

I didn’t realize how much I wanted this, be quiet,

just be quiet now.
